Code P1800 Buick Description

The P1800 Buick code refers to a communication error between the Engine Control Module (ECM) and the Transmission Control Module (TCM) related to the engine coolant signal. In modern vehicles, the ECM and TCM work together to ensure smooth operation and optimal performance. The engine coolant signal is crucial for the overall functioning of the engine and transmission systems as it helps regulate the temperature and prevent overheating. When this signal is disrupted or not properly communicated between the ECM and TCM, it can lead to various issues that affect the vehicle's performance and drivability.

Common Causes of P1800 Buick

  1. Faulty engine coolant temperature sensor
  2. Wiring or connection issues between ECM and TCM
  3. ECM or TCM malfunction
  4. Low coolant level
  5. Software or programming issues

Symptoms of P1800 Buick

  1. Engine overheating
  2. Transmission shifting issues
  3. Reduced engine power
  4. Check Engine Light illuminated
  5. Poor fuel efficiency

How to Fix P1800 Buick

  1. Diagnose the exact cause of the communication error by using a scan tool to retrieve the trouble codes and perform a thorough inspection of the engine coolant system.
  2. Check the engine coolant temperature sensor for proper operation and replace if necessary.
  3. Inspect the wiring harness and connections between the ECM and TCM for any damage or corrosion, repairing or replacing as needed.
  4. Perform a software update or reprogramming of the ECM and TCM to ensure proper communication and functionality.
  5. Test drive the vehicle to confirm the issue has been resolved and reset the trouble codes.

Cost to Fix P1800 Buick

The cost of repairing a P1800 Buick code can vary depending on the specific cause of the issue and the labor rates at the auto repair shop. Typically, the parts needed for this repair, such as a coolant temperature sensor or wiring harness, may range from $50 to $200. The labor costs can add another $100 to $300, totaling around $150 to $500 for the entire repair.
